The appeal of Attar Collection fragrances lies in their commitment to traditional perfumery techniques while embracing contemporary sensibilities. This brand is renowned for its exquisite attars, which are concentrated perfumes derived from natural sources, often flowers, herbs, and spices. Unlike Western perfumes that rely heavily on alcohol as a base, attars are typically oil-based, allowing for a richer, more intimate scent projection that melds beautifully with the wearer's skin. Attar Collection Azora exemplifies this philosophy, presenting a fragrance that is both sophisticated and deeply personal. The Art of Attar Application

Applying an attar like Azora is a subtle art form. Unlike spraying a perfume, attars are typically applied directly to the pulse points using the rollerball or by dabbing a small amount. The warmth generated by these points helps to diffuse the fragrance naturally. Key application areas include:

  • Wrists
  • Behind the ears
  • The crook of the elbows
  • Behind the knees

A little goes a long way with attars. It’s advisable to start with a minimal amount and build up if desired. The goal is to create a subtle, personal aura rather than an overpowering scent cloud. This method of application allows the fragrance to interact intimately with your skin chemistry, creating a scent that is uniquely yours.
